    Orange County girls basketball Top 25: No. 2 Sage Hill set for tough tournament
    • November 25, 2025

    Support our high school sports coverage by becoming a digital subscriber. Subscribe now


    The first in-season rankings for Orange County girls basketball on Monday, Nov. 24. The team records are through Sunday, Nov. 23.

    ORANGE COUNTY GIRLS BASKETBALL TOP 25

    1. Mater Dei (1-0): The Monarchs play host to Bishop Montgomery (1-1) on Tuesday to open their first Holiday Classic. Mater Dei is No. 9 in the MaxPreps national preseason rankings.

    Previous ranking: 1

    2. Sage Hill (1-0): The Lightning play Carondelet, which they lost to in the state Division I final last season, at the Battle at the Beach tournament Friday at Redondo. The tournament also features reigning state Open champion Etiwanda.

    Previous ranking: 2

    3. Fairmont Prep (1-0): The Huskies face Sierra Canyon at the Pacifica Christian showcase on Tuesday at 7 p.m.

    Previous ranking: 3

    4. San Clemente (4-0): Izzy Sims scored 22 points as the Tritons defeated San Juan Hills 56-46 in the finals of the Oxford Academy tournament.

    Previous ranking: 4

    5. Villa Park (4-0): Olivia Sturdivant earned MVP honors after the Spartans won the Villa Park/Portola Kickoff Classic.

    Previous ranking: 6

    6. JSerra (3-1): The Lions, the runner-up at the Villa Park-Portola tournament, play Lynwood in a single game Friday at Redondo.

    Previous ranking: 5

    7. Esperanza (0-0): The Aztecs play reigning CIF-SS Open Division champion Ontario Christian on Tuesday.

    Previous ranking: 8

    8. Portola (3-1): Kara Niho and Madison Nguyen averaged 15 and 13 points, respectively, as the Bulldogs placed third at their Villa Park-Portola Kickoff Classic.

    Previous ranking: 9

    9. Troy (2-2): Mei-Ling Perry averaged 20.5 points to help the Warriors finish fourth at the Villa Park-Portola Kickoff Classic.

    Previous ranking: 10

    10. San Juan Hills (3-1): Adelyn Boberg averaged 19.5 points en route to all-tournament honors at the Oxford Academy tournament.

    Previous ranking: Not ranked
